The length of time does a normal divorce take?

Georgia law allows a divorce case to be settled 31 days after the defendant has been served with required paperwork. We can get a settlement agreement submitted earlier than that, but the judge is mandated to wait until the 31st day after service has been perfected on the defendant to complete the documentation.

A case might take anywhere from 2 to 6 months if a final hearing in front of a judge is not needed however a number of concerns need to be dealt with.

A number of cases are dealt with at the mediation phase or through other formal settlements.

Exactly what is the distinction between an uncontested divorce and a contested divorce in Gwinnett County?

An uncontested divorce case is one in which a signed settlement agreement is sent to the clerk's office at the time the complaint for divorce is filed.

How come my divorce doesn't qualify under your flat-fee prices?

If your divorce consists of issues such as not agreeing on child custody, non-agreement over spousal support or not agreeing on the division of marital items, a flat-fee divorce is usually not an alternative. It is difficult to anticipate whether your case can be dealt with promptly or if it will take significantly longer to finish.
